Regional Distribution of the Cromey Surname

The Cromey surname is most prevalent in the United States, with 206 incidences recorded. It is also found in significant numbers in England (90), Northern Ireland (77), Ireland (16), Canada (8), Wales (6), Scotland (4), Australia (1), New Zealand (1), and Trinidad and Tobago (1).
